Dessert is the medium Shafna Shamsuddin uses to tell her story. The creator of a cardamom-infused ice cream company, Elaka Treats, finds inspiration in childhood Indian traditions, but says her story begins at an American store.

“My story started at Williams-Sonoma,” Shamsuddin said. Born and raised in the United Arab Emirates by Indian immigrant parents, Shamsuddin came to the U.S. to attend Purdue University. She later earned a degree at UNC Charlotte after being matched with her husband and relocating to Gastonia.
